免疫层析法同时检测孕妇TORCH—IgM抗体的研究

摘    要:目的建立一种免疫层析法用于同时检测孕妇血清中TORCH—IgM抗体。方法用胶体金标记羊抗人IgM(斗链)抗体,将巨细胞病毒(CMV)、风疹病毒(RV)、弓形体(Tox)、单纯疱疹病毒Ⅱ型(HSV-Ⅱ)四种重组抗原同时包被在硝酸纤维膜上,研制出同时检测TORCH—IgM抗体免疫层析试纸条。结果自制的免疫层析法与ELISA法对比检测阴阳性血清标本,各单项指标抗-CMV—IgM、抗-RV—IgM、抗-Tox—IgM、抗-HSV-Ⅱ-IgM阳性符合率分别为85.7%、100%、100%、100%,两法总符合率分别为97.9%、100%、100%、100%。结论本方法操作简便,显示结果直观,并且特异、稳定、快速、重复性好,可用于孕妇优生优育检测。

Abstract:Objective: To develope an immunochromatography test for simultaneously detecting of TORCH -IgM serum antibody for pregnant women. Methods: We labeled Goat anti human IgM ( μ chain) antibody with Colloidal gold, enveloped four recombinant antigen including cytomegalovirus (CMV), rubella virus (RV), toxoplasmosis (Tox) , herpes simplex virus type Ⅱ (HSV - Ⅱ) in nitrocellulose membrane at the same, to developed an immunochromatographic test strips for simultaneously detecting of TORCH - IgM antibody. Results : Compared this self -maded immunochromatography test with the ELISA method by evaluation of positive and negative serum, The positive coincidence rate of anti - CMV - IgM, anti - RubV - IgM, anti - Tox - IgM, anti - HSV - Ⅱ - IgM was 85.7%, 100%, 100%, 100% respectively. The total coincidence rate was 97. 9%, 100%, 100%, 100% respectively. Conclusions: This method is simple and the test results can be visualy displayed. Furthermore, it is specific, stable, rapid and repeatable enough to be used in pregnant women detection for good prenatal and postnatal care.
